Handing over the Fernwick incremental rebuild system. Key detail: the dependency graph is persisted between runs, so a corrupted graph file causes silent full rebuilds — check timings if builds slow down. The invalidation logic lives in the planner module; change it cautiously and always run the snapshot tests. Complete architecture notes and failure modes are written up here:

dashboard of kafof-tahaf = https://confluence.tolvaqsys.internal/projects/browse/display/a1250987

## Build Provenance — Coldpath Handlers

Cold starts on the Murkfield serverless tier are provenance-sensitive: the init snapshot is baked at build time, so any unverified layer inflates startup by ~800ms. Always rebuild handlers from the pinned base image; never patch layers in place. Provenance attestations live alongside each artifact in the Coldpath store. When auditing a slow cold start, match the deployed snapshot against the token that follows.

build token for yaweg-fawig: htk4_45ef

Q: What should I check before approving changes to Pedalshift's rebalancing solver?

A: Verify that the demand-forecast inputs are normalized per dock cluster, that the truck-capacity constraints in the Harbrook config are respected, and that the dry-run mode still produces a diff rather than dispatching moves. If the solver's state store must be restored during review, you will need the team's shared recovery credential, which is recorded immediately below.

vault phrase of tajop-haduf = holath-brivan-wenax

# Break-Glass: Catalog Cache Invalidation

Scope: the Pinrow product catalog at Veldstone Retail. If stale prices persist after a purge and the Hollowmere invalidation queue is wedged, use break-glass to flush the edge tier directly. Contractors: get verbal sign-off from the catalog lead first. Steps: open the Hollowmere admin shell, select emergency-flush, confirm the tenant, and run it once — repeated flushes thrash the origin. Access is logged and expires after 20 minutes. Unseal the admin shell with the passphrase below.

recovery phrase for kahop-tajog: istix-casvan